WHAT'S INTERNET SCRAPING AND HOW DOES IT OPERATE?

What's Internet Scraping and How Does It Operate?

What's Internet Scraping and How Does It Operate?

Blog Article

World-wide-web scraping, generally known as Internet info extraction or Net harvesting, is the process of automating the retrieval of data from Sites. It consists of working with program packages or scripts to accessibility Web content, extract precise knowledge, and retailer it in a structured structure for even more Evaluation or use.

In the present info-pushed entire world, organizations, scientists, and folks often will need to gather substantial amounts of facts from different on line sources. World-wide-web scraping gives a robust Answer to successfully gather and Arrange this important details. By automating the method, Website scraping removes the need for guide copying and pasting, conserving effort and time whilst making certain precision and regularity.

Understanding Internet Scraping
World wide web scraping could be the practice of extracting information from Internet sites working with automatic application or scripts. These resources can navigate by Websites, parse the HTML or other structured information formats, and extract the specified facts. The extracted data can then be saved inside a database, spreadsheet, or another suitable structure for even more processing or Examination.

As an instance how World-wide-web scraping performs, let's look at an easy example. Visualize you'll want to Obtain pricing details for a specific products from a variety of e-commerce Internet sites. Manually visiting Just about every Site, finding the solution, and copying the price facts could be a time-consuming and mistake-prone undertaking. With Internet scraping, you could create a script that mechanically visits Every Web page, locates the item website page, and extracts the relevant pricing details.

Vital Components of Net Scraping
World-wide-web scraping involves a number of crucial parts:

Website Crawler: A program or script that immediately navigates by way of Sites by pursuing hyperlinks and retrieving Web content.
HTML Parser: A ingredient that analyzes the composition and content of HTML or other structured information formats to determine and extract the desired information and facts.
Info Extraction: The entire process of extracting certain info factors from your web pages, like textual content, visuals, one-way links, or tables, based upon predefined policies or designs.
Information Storage: The extracted details is usually stored in a structured structure, such as a databases, CSV file, or spreadsheet, for more Evaluation or processing.
Why is Website Scraping Significant?
Net scraping offers a lot of Rewards and applications across various industries and domains. Here are several reasons why World-wide-web scraping is very important:

Details Aggregation: Net scraping allows you to acquire details from several resources and consolidate it into only one, structured format for Examination or conclusion-creating.
Current market Research: Organizations can use World-wide-web scraping to assemble insights about competitors, pricing trends, solution opinions, and shopper sentiments.
Price Monitoring: Internet scraping enables serious-time tracking of costs across many e-commerce platforms, assisting firms remain competitive and make informed pricing choices.
Lead Generation: By extracting Speak to information along with other appropriate knowledge from Internet websites, corporations can generate sales opportunities and discover potential customers.
Academic Research: Researchers can leverage World-wide-web scraping to gather info for experiments, surveys, or Assessment in many fields, such as social sciences, economics, and linguistics.
Content material Aggregation: Net scraping is commonly used to mixture news articles or blog posts, weblog posts, or other on line articles from multiple sources for written content curation or Evaluation.
Lawful and Moral Criteria
Although World-wide-web scraping may be a strong Software, It is vital to be familiar with and comply with the legal and ethical factors included. Here are several vital details to remember:

Conditions of Company: Many Web sites have terms of support that prohibit or limit World wide web scraping functions. It can be very important to evaluate and adjust to these conditions to stop probable lawful issues.
Mental Assets Legal rights: Respect copyrights along with other intellectual assets legal rights when scraping knowledge from Sites. Stay away from scraping and distributing copyrighted material with out authorization.
Knowledge Privacy: Be conscious of data privateness legal guidelines and regulations, specially when scraping private or delicate data.
Server Load: Excessive or intense Internet scraping can place a major load on a website's servers, perhaps creating overall performance difficulties or support disruptions. It is really necessary to carry out measures to guarantee your scraping actions will not overburden the target Web sites.
Finest Tactics for Internet Scraping
To be sure moral and dependable Website scraping practices, take into account the next finest tactics:

Regard Robots.txt: The robots.txt file on a web site specifies which areas are off-limits to Internet crawlers. Adhere to these guidelines and stay away from scraping restricted locations.
Put into action Crawl Delays: Introduce intentional delays amongst requests in order to avoid mind-boggling the goal Web site's servers.
Identify Yourself: Lots of Web-sites have mechanisms to establish and most likely block scraping pursuits. Contemplate identifying your scraper during the consumer-agent string or furnishing Get in touch with information for transparency.
Get hold of Consent: When scraping info from websites that involve authentication or entail delicate data, think about acquiring explicit consent or permission from the web site proprietors or applicable events.
Use Proxies or Rotating IP Addresses: To stay away from IP blocking or charge-restricting steps, consider using proxies or rotating IP addresses in your scraping activities.
Comply with Facts Privateness Laws: Be sure that your Internet scraping procedures adjust to relevant data privacy legal guidelines and restrictions, including the General Info Defense Regulation (GDPR) or perhaps the California Purchaser Privateness Act (CCPA).
Summary
Web scraping is a powerful system that permits the automated extraction of information from Sites. It offers several Positive aspects and apps throughout a variety of industries, from current market exploration and selling price monitoring to academic study and content material aggregation. Nevertheless, It is crucial to understand and adjust to authorized and ethical criteria, regard intellectual assets legal rights, and put into action best tactics to be sure accountable and sustainable Website scraping functions.

By subsequent the guidelines outlined in the following paragraphs, you'll be able to leverage the strength of Net scraping while minimizing opportunity pitfalls and maintaining a constructive relationship Along with the Web sites you communicate with. Given that the digital landscape carries on to evolve, World-wide-web scraping will remain an priceless Resource for data-driven determination-earning and study.

soft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os

Report this page